码迷,mamicode.com
首页 > 系统相关 > 月排行
Linux-open函数
open函数的flag详解1 读写权限:O_RDONLY O_WRONLY O_RDWR (1)linux中文件有读写权限,我们在open打开文件时也可以附带一定的权限说明 (譬如O_RDONLY就表示以只读方式打开,O_WRONLY表示以只写方式打开, O_RDWR表示以可读可写方式打开) (2) ...
分类:系统相关   时间:2018-02-26 14:57:46    阅读次数:196
Linux之扩展正则表达式(egrep)
egrep:支持扩展的正则表达式实现类似于grep文本过滤功能:grep-Egrep[OPTIONS]PATTERN[FILE...]grep[OPTIONS][-ePATTERN|-fFILE][FILE...]选项:--color=auto:对匹配到的文本着色后高亮显示:-i:ignorecase,忽略字符的大小写:-o:仅显示匹配到的字符串本身:-v,--invert-match:显示不能被
分类:系统相关   时间:2018-02-26 14:58:06    阅读次数:300
Linux用户和组管理
Linux用户和组管理安全上下文:进程以其发起者的身份运行:进程对文件的访问权限取决于发起此进程的用户的权限系统用户:为了能够让那些后台进程或服务类进程以非管理员身份运行,通常需要为此创建多个普通用户,这类用户不用登陆系统:groupadd命令:添加组groupadd[options]group-gGID:指定GID:默认是上一个组的GID+1:-r:创建系统组:groupmod命令:修改组信息g
分类:系统相关   时间:2018-02-26 15:01:29    阅读次数:218
从汇编角度来理解linux下多层函数调用堆栈运行状态
我们用下面的C代码来研究函数调用的过程。 C++ Code 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 int bar(int c, int d) { int e = c + d; return e; }int foo(int a, int b) { return  ...
分类:系统相关   时间:2018-02-26 15:02:15    阅读次数:247
Linux进程地址空间和虚拟内存
一、虚拟内存 先来看一张图(来自《Linux内核完全剖析》),如下: 分段机制:即分成代码段,数据段,堆栈段。每个内存段都与一个特权级相关联,即0~3,0具有最高特权级(内核),3则是最低特权级(用户),每当程序试图访问(权限又分为可读、可写和可执行)一个段时,当前特权级CPL就会与段的特权级进行比 ...
分类:系统相关   时间:2018-02-26 15:03:02    阅读次数:221
Linux之常用文本查看及处理工具
wc:word count? ? ? ? wc [OPTION]... [FILE]...? ? ? ??? ? ? ? ?-l:lines? ? ? ? ?-w:words? ? &nbs
分类:系统相关   时间:2018-02-26 15:07:58    阅读次数:211
CISCO网络基础小实验第六节
本文讲述生成树的基本原理作用算法及配置,
分类:系统相关   时间:2018-02-26 15:09:10    阅读次数:152
Linux之基本正则表达式(grep)
**正则表达式:Regual Expression,简写REGEXP**由一类特殊字符及文本字符编写的模式,其中有些字符不表示其字面意义,而是用于表示控制或通配的功能:分两类: 基本正则表达式:BRE 扩展正则表达式:ERE 元字符:\(hello[[:space:]]\+\)\+grep: Global search REgulae expresslon and Print out
分类:系统相关   时间:2018-02-26 15:09:35    阅读次数:245
Linux 关闭与重启
普通用户没有权限使用shutdown命令,只有root用户才有权限。 shutdown [选项] 时间 [警告消息] 系统关机 ¨ -c 取消前一个shutdown命令。值得注意的是,当执行一个如“shutdown -h 11:10”的命令时,只要按“Ctrl+C”键就可以中断关机的命令。 ¨ -f ...
分类:系统相关   时间:2018-02-26 15:11:47    阅读次数:207
Linux之find命令详解
find:实时查找工具,通过遍历指定起始路径下文件系统层级结构完成文件查找:工作特性:查找速度略慢:精确查找:实时查找:用法:find[OPTIONS][查找起始路径][查找条件][出路动作]查找起始路径;指定具体搜索目标其实路径;默认为当前目录查找条件;指定的查找标准,可以根据文件名、大小、类型、从属关系、权限等标准进行;默认为找出指定路径下的所有文件;处理动作;对符合查找条件的文件做出的操作,
分类:系统相关   时间:2018-02-26 15:11:57    阅读次数:214
Linux简单的文件读取
(1)linux中的文件描述符fd的合法范围是0或者一个正正数,不可能是一个负数。 (2)open返回的fd程序必须记录好,以后向这个文件的所有操作都要靠这个fd去对应这个文件,最后关闭文件时也需要fd去指定关闭这个文件。如果在我们关闭文件前fd丢掉了那就惨了,这个文件没法关闭了也没法读写了。 提醒 ...
分类:系统相关   时间:2018-02-26 15:15:08    阅读次数:159
Linux常用命令
[stu@localhost~]$ 其中,'Stu'为登录用户名,'localhost'为登录主机名,’~’ 表示当前用户正处在stu用户的家目录中,’$’则表示当前登录用户为普通用户 根据 Bourne Shell 的传统,普通用户的提示符以'$'结尾,而根用户以’#’结尾 ’~’ 符号不是一个固 ...
分类:系统相关   时间:2018-02-26 15:16:53    阅读次数:262
Linux 124课程 10、分析存储日志
Linux 7中日志的基本系统架构 发现和解释日志记录在系统日志内容查看 syslog文件条目 时间同步和时区配置
分类:系统相关   时间:2018-02-26 16:13:52    阅读次数:224
Linux 124课程 11、网络管理
1、解释计算机网络的基本概念  TCP/IP四层协议    应用层HTTPFTPCIFSSSH  传输层端口号TCP/UDP  网络层IPv4和IPv6ipv432bit  数据链路层MAC地址48bit    IP地址:172.17.5.3172.25.5.3172.25.5.4  255.255.0.0255.255.255.0255.255.255.0  子网掩码的作用区分网络位和主机位
分类:系统相关   时间:2018-02-26 16:15:14    阅读次数:229
01: shell基本使用
1.1 编写登录欢迎脚本 (1)新建脚本文件welcome.sh,用来输出各种监控信息。 [root@localhost ~]# vi /root/welcome.sh #!/bin/bash echo "已开启进程数:$(ps aux | wc -l)" echo "已登录用户数:$(who | ...
分类:系统相关   时间:2018-02-26 16:17:53    阅读次数:183
linux 用户 组 和权限管理
Multi-task Multi-Users 每个使用者: 用户标识 、 密码: Authentication(认证机制): Authorization (授权机制): Account / Audition (审计): 组:用户组,用户容器 用户类别: 管理 普通用户 系统用户 登录用户 用户标识: ...
分类:系统相关   时间:2018-02-26 16:23:52    阅读次数:233
在Ubuntu16.04上使用Autofs
在Solaris上,autofs是默认安装的,可以通过/net/<NFS server>很方便地访问远程的共享目录。但在Linux上(例如Fedora或者Ubuntu),使用autofs则需要自己安装和配置。本文将以Ubuntu16.04作为NFS client, 简单介绍一下如何使用autofs。 ...
分类:系统相关   时间:2018-02-26 16:25:15    阅读次数:478
eclipse中maven打包
第一种方式:将依赖包打包进一个jar包中。 第二种方式: 将依赖包单独放到lib文件夹中 ...
分类:系统相关   时间:2018-02-26 17:36:33    阅读次数:212
linux环境安装redis及扩展
安装redis 1、下载源码,解压缩后编译源码。 2、编译完成后,在Src目录下,有四个可执行文件redis-server、redis-benchmark、redis-cli和redis.conf。然后拷贝到一个目录下。(redis.conf 也有可能在上一层) 3、启动Redis服务。 4、然后用 ...
分类:系统相关   时间:2018-02-26 17:40:09    阅读次数:261
eclipse怎么查看class文件(eclipse安装反编译插件)
本人eclipse版本: Eclipse Java EE IDE for Web Developers. Version: Mars.2 Release (4.5.2) 步骤1:下载两个我们需要的东西 (1)下载jadclipse插件: 下载地址:https://sourceforge.net/pr ...
分类:系统相关   时间:2018-02-26 17:41:43    阅读次数:181
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!